Debian 10이 있고 다음을 사용하여 wine5를 설치했습니다.
sudo apt install --install-recommends winehq-stable
Notepad++를 실행하려고 하면 다음 오류가 발생합니다.
0009:fixme:font:get_outline_text_metrics failed to read full_nameW for font L"Ani"!
0009:fixme:win:LockWindowUpdate (0x1004e), partial stub!
0009:fixme:imm:ImmReleaseContext (000100F0, 0110C888): stub
0009:fixme:win:LockWindowUpdate ((nil)), partial stub!
0009:fixme:msg:ChangeWindowMessageFilterEx 0x1004e 4a 1 (nil)
0009:fixme:win:LockWindowUpdate (0x1004e), partial stub!
0009:fixme:win:LockWindowUpdate ((nil)), partial stub!
0009:fixme:ver:GetCurrentPackageId (0x32fe94 (nil)): stub
다른 것을 설치해야 할 것 같은데 무엇인지 모르겠습니다.
sudo apt list --installed | grep wine
프로그램
fonts-wine/stable,stable,now 4.0-2 all [installed]
wine-stable-amd64/unknown,now 5.0.0~buster amd64 [installed,automatic]
wine-stable-i386/unknown,now 5.0.0~buster i386 [installed,automatic]
wine-stable/unknown,now 5.0.0~buster amd64 [installed,automatic]
winehq-stable/unknown,now 5.0.0~buster amd64 [installed]
와인 버전:
wine --version
wine-5.0
winecfg를 실행하면 다음과 같은 결과를 얻습니다.
wine: Read access denied for device L"\\??\\Z:\\", FS volume label and serial are not available.
답변1
댓글을 남길 만큼 평판이 충분하지 않아 답변으로 다음을 입력합니다.
어떤 레포를 사용하셨나요? 이것이 문제의 원인일 수 있습니다. v5의 새로운 기능이 필요하지 않다면 공식 Debian 10 저장소에서 v4를 사용해 볼 수 있습니다. 내 Debian 10 시스템에서는 Wine 4.0 또는 Wine 4.2 개발을 사용할 수 있습니다. 또한 사용 가능한 버스터 백포트 버전이 없습니다.
답변2
마침내 다음을 사용하여 설치할 수 있었습니다.
sudo apt-get install winehq-stable
그래서 이제 이해해요
wine --version
wine-5.15
내가 실행한 원래 명령과 이 명령의 차이점을 잘 모르겠습니다. 원래 명령은 데비안의 winehq 웹사이트에 언급된 명령입니다.
https://wiki.winehq.org/Debian
, 그래서 나는 그것이 작동할 것이라고 생각합니다. 이제 Notepad++, HeidiSQL 등을 사용할 수 있습니다.
적절한 소스의 경우 /etc/apt/sources.list.d/wine.list에 있습니다.
deb https://dl.winehq.org/wine-builds/debian/ buster main
/etc/apt/sources.list에 나는
deb https://download.opensuse.org/repositories/Emulators:/Wine:/Debian/Debian_10 ./
어느 것을 사용하는지 잘 모르겠습니다.